Rise of the Ronin: How to perform a Bond Transfer? Transfer of Power trophy
Transfer of Ties is an action related to the bronze trophy Transfer of Power from the game Rise of the Ronin. In the tutorial, we show you how to transfer a selected trait from a source item to a target item.
In Rise of the Ronin, a mechanic called Bond Transfer allows upgrading equipment items by transferring properties from the source item to the destination item. On this page of our guide, we describe the requirements and the sequence of actions needed for performing a Bond Transfer, whose successful completion also unlocks the Transfer of Power trophy.
Preparations for relocation - Bond Jewel
- To perform one Bond Transfer and successfully unlock the related achievement, you need at least one Bond Jewel (you can look up how much you have of them in the first tab of the inventory screen - screenshot above).
- Bond Jewels are quite rare in the world of the game. You can get them e.g. as a reward for chosen missions or by completing Photography Challenges (Photography Studios on region maps).

How to perform Bond Transfer at a blacksmith?

- Visit any blacksmith - you will find at least one such NPC in each of the main cities.
- After talking to the craftsman, select the Bond Transfer option from the menu (screenshot above). You need to choose what property you want to transfer from item 1 to item 2. It has a practical use if you have acquired an item with some useful feature (e.g. extension of the hero's health bar or a bonus to Ki regeneration).

On the screen 2 slots for equipment will appear:
- Destination Item - here you put the item you want to improve and add a new property to.
- Transfer Item- the slot on the right is for the item you want to remove the trait from and transfer it to the Destination Item. It is very important to remember that the Transfer Item will be destroyed after the process. Do not sacrifice an item from a rare set or one you may find a use for later.
An exemplary transfer of a property to the left item we marked with a yellow arrow in the screenshot.

Bond Transfer is not free of charge. You'll need:
- 1 or more Bond Jewel- the higher quality the item you want to transfer the property from, the more Jewels spent.
- Crafting materials - you can find them as loot, buy, or receive e.g. as quest rewards.
- Coins - a single transfer may cost several or even tens of thousands of coins.
